LOG's home base is at 30-32 Paradise Island, off Surfers Paradise Boulevard. That means our trucks roll out from inside the suburb on the morning of your move, not from a depot in Yatala or Brisbane. If your move is in Surfers, we are usually on site within 15 minutes of leaving the yard.

The towers around Cavill, Orchid Avenue and the Esplanade need building access just as much as they need lifting strength. We have worked with the management offices at most of the big buildings, so when you give us the address we already know whether the service lift takes a fridge, what the loading bay height limit is, and whether we need a building bond on the day. Less of that on you to chase down.

For houses, the back streets of Chevron Island, Isle of Capri and Budds Beach can get tight when a truck has to navigate between palm trees and mailboxes. Our rigid trucks are sized for residential access, not the 12-tonne pantechnicons that get stuck at the second corner.

Do you handle lift bookings in Surfers Paradise towers?

Yes. Most of the big buildings — Circle on Cavill, Chevron Renaissance, Q1, Soul, Hilton Surfers, Mantra Towers — require a lift booking and a refundable bond for the service lift. Tell us the building when you book and we coordinate with the building manager. We bring our own lift padding so the bond rarely gets touched.

My building has restricted parking. Where do you load?

Most Surfers towers have a loading bay or service-vehicle bay in the basement carpark, accessed via a service ramp with a height clearance — usually 2.6m to 3.1m. Our trucks are sized to fit. If the building only has metered street parking, we can use the council short-stay loading zones on Cavill, Orchid, or Surfers Paradise Boulevard, depending on the address.

Can you move a furnished holiday-let apartment?

Yes, we do these often. Investors swapping a furnished unit between buildings, owners taking a unit off short-let to live in, or new owners receiving a furnished settlement. Tell us what stays and what goes when you book and we will tag-and-load it accordingly. Most furnished one-bed moves run 3 to 4 hours.

How do you handle moves during big events like Schoolies or NYE?

We avoid the road closures. Around Schoolies (mid-November) and New Year Eve, the Esplanade and parts of Cavill Avenue close from afternoon into the night. We book those moves for early morning slots, well before any closures, and route the truck through Ferny Avenue or the Gold Coast Highway rather than the beach strip.

Are penthouse moves more expensive?

Not because of the floor number — the lift does the work either way. Penthouse moves cost more when the contents are bigger or heavier (more furniture, heavier custom pieces, sometimes pianos or pool tables) or when there are two service lifts to coordinate. We quote based on contents and access, not floor height.
